LAHORE, June 19: The Punjab government claimed on Thursday that the total outlay of its budget is Rs416.94 billion, and not Rs389 billion as reported by the press.Speaking at the post-budget session of the Punjab Assembly, Punjab Finance Minister Tanveer Ashraf Kaira explained that Rs256 billion had been allocated for ‘running expenditure’ and Rs160 billion for the annual development plan. Thus, the total size of the provincial budget stands at Rs416.94 billion. — Staff Reporter
